On Wed, 2003-08-27 at 21:57, Andreas Schuldei wrote: > > this patch makes it possibel to select which busid the xserver > should operate on. this is handy if two or more graphic cards in > a box run independent xservers and need to reset the card > independently from the other xserver. this patch features the > requested clean up configuration interface via the XF86Config > file. then one can write stuff like this in ones config: > > Section "ServerLayout" > Identifier "X0" > Screen 0 "Screen0" 0 0 > InputDevice "Mouse2" "CorePointer" > InputDevice "Keyboard0" "CoreKeyboard" > Option "PrefBusID" "1:0:0" > EndSection
